Frozen Pipe Water Removal Cost In Stem, NC

Frozen pipe water removal costs vary based on the size of the area and the amount of damage. These are general estimates to give you an idea. You should get a free estimate for your specific situation. The cost can be higher if there’s mold or structural damage.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water extraction $500 – $2,500 Amount of water and location of the leak
Drying and dehumidification $1,000 – $4,000 Size of the area and humidity levels
Sanitization $300 – $1,500 Amount of contamination and type of surfaces
Repair and restoration $2,000 – $8,000 Extent of damage and materials needed
Insurance documentation $200 – $1,000 Complexity of the claim and number of documents
Emergency response $500 – $2,000 Time of day and urgency of the call

How can I prevent frozen pipe water damage?

To prevent frozen pipe water damage, keep your home warm and insulate pipes in cold areas. You should also let faucets drip during extreme cold. This helps prevent ice buildup. If you’re away from home, leave the heat on. You can also use space heaters in vulnerable areas. Prevention is the best way to avoid big problems.
